“Thou hast visited me in the night.” Believe me, there are such<br />

things as personal visits from Jesus to His people. <strong>He</strong> has not<br />

left us utterly. Though <strong>He</strong> be not seen with the bodily eye by<br />

bush or brook, nor on the mount, nor by the sea, yet doth <strong>He</strong><br />

come and go, observed only by the spirit, felt only by the heart.<br />

Still he standeth behind our wall, <strong>He</strong> showeth Himself through<br />

the lattices.<br />
